Cincinnati, Ohio: May 20, 1913 Workmen standing on the ledge of the Union Central Building throw flowers down on the passing streetcars in honor of the end of the streetcar traction strike. Only a few days before blocks of concrete and iron bars were thrown down by the strike sympathizers, demolishing one streetcar and narrowly avoiding injuring many people.
